Transaction 909127954ad5670e03ea0b5d75a01a7b71acf7237a6daf470c4c59d1f5132d3a

1 Input
2 Outputs
  • 909127954ad5670e03ea0b5d75a01a7b71acf7237a6daf470c4c59d1f5132d3a:0
  • value  22050
    address  1JNGSadJY6Jv5JJy8rhnPbG7GjhYWANdEH
  • 909127954ad5670e03ea0b5d75a01a7b71acf7237a6daf470c4c59d1f5132d3a:1
  • value  46838730
    address  3LvS6r1mFvxjK7dc2zTfgL3Jq7hUxpjsmw